I did some today with a couple of prototypes. They were kind of as I had expected. The missiles without angled fins are very erratic if there is any wind. The spinning missiles all grouped around 70 feet with maximum (OPRV venting) pressure from a Roto-Rocket. One of them exploded out the front because the pressure was too high for that molded type of tube sleeve. I was hoping using found object liners would be easier to acquire (and net me the candy they were containing) but they don't appear to be strong enough. Also, I just blew the side out of an unlined missile using OPRV pressure, though it was getting about 60 feet until then. I was able to immediately repair it by simply sliding in a tube liner and promptly shot it in to the tree. 80-ish feet away.
I need to build some more units now that I have resigned myself to the more expensive design.

In a package Draconis sent me last week, he included two missiles (alongside the Roto Rocket-equivalent). I'm not sure how similar these are to the design that he created, but they fit on the stock barrel, have some sort of wrap on the inside of the bored hole to prevent blowouts (it feels like a plastic tube), they have fins, and they have half a foam golf ball at the tip. They fly SUPER far. Even with a leak in the tubing on the way to the Roto Rocket I can get them to fire at least eighty feet, and they fly reasonably straight.

I'm a big fan, hence my vote that I would buy some if the opportunity presented itself. They fly way better than Titan missiles.
